About the area
Obama Onsen, a neighbourhood in Unzen, is home to Unzen Obama Onsen Juraku.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Unzen-Amakusa National Park and Tokenyama Park, while Vidoro Museum and Unzen Toy Museum are cultural highlights. Ariakenomori Flowerpark and Tsukinooka Park are also worth visiting.

We should mention
The Japanese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are requires all international visitors to submit their passport number and nationality when registering at any lodging facility (inns, hotels, motels, etc. ); additionally, lodging proprietors are required to photocopy passports for all registering guests and keep the photocopy on file
